7.11.6 Clear counters and diagnostic register (sub-command code: 0x0A)

Clears counters (e.g. message count).
The following counters will be cleared. (Refer to Chapter 6)
• Bus message count
• Bus communication error count
• Exception error count
• Slave message count
• Slave no-response count
• Slave NAK count
• Slave busy count
• Character overrun error count
• Communications event count (Refer to Section 7.12)

1) Request message format (Master → Slave)
2) Response message format (Slave→ Master)
(When completed normally)
The slave returns the request message received from the master without change.
(When completed with an error)
*1. Exception and error codes are stored in special data registers and special auxiliary relays in the case
of error completion. Refer to Chapter 6 for storage location, confirmation methods, and other detailed
contents.
